Fortifying Data Foundations


Data integrity stands as a paramount concern for any storage solution. The WALRAM M.2 NGFF SATA3 SSD leverages 3D NAND Flash technology, a crucial advancement in memory architecture. This technology stacks memory cells vertically, allowing for higher storage densities and improved endurance compared to older 2D NAND designs. The physical construction of the drive, while exposed on a PCB, is engineered for resilience within its intended operating environment.

For the user, this translates into a more reliable repository for critical files and operating system installations. The enhanced endurance of 3D NAND means the drive can withstand more write cycles over its lifespan, reducing the long-term risk of cell degradation. This is vital for system stability. The Interface of Speed and Security


This WALRAM SSD utilizes the SATA III 6Gb/s interface, a widely adopted standard that provides a substantial bandwidth improvement over its predecessors. While not reaching the peak speeds of NVMe drives, SATA III still delivers sequential read and write speeds that dramatically outperform any mechanical hard drive. The M.2 connector itself is designed for a secure, direct connection to the motherboard, minimizing potential points of failure often associated with external cabling.

Proper installation is key to maintaining this secure connection. The M.2 slot ensures a snug fit, reducing the chances of accidental disconnection or data corruption due to loose contacts. This direct integration also eliminates the need for power and data cables, simplifying internal system layouts and improving airflow. A cleaner build is a more reliable build.

In contrast to older SATA SSDs that required separate power and data cables, the M.2 form factor integrates both into a single, compact module. This design choice not only streamlines the installation process but also reduces cable clutter, which can impede airflow within a chassis. The connection is robust.

Safeguarding Your Digital Assets


From a data security perspective, the WALRAM M.2 NGFF SATA3 SSD, like many drives in its class, does not feature integrated hardware encryption. This is a critical consideration for users with stringent security requirements. The absence of self-encrypting drive (SED) capabilities means that data protection relies entirely on software-based solutions provided by the operating system or third-party applications.

Users concerned about unauthorized access to their data should immediately implement full disk encryption using tools such as BitLocker for Windows or FileVault for macOS. These software solutions, while effective, can introduce a minor performance overhead. Data protection is paramount.

Compared to enterprise-grade SSDs that often include TCG Opal 2.0 or eDrive hardware encryption, this consumer-grade drive prioritizes cost-effectiveness and general performance. The trade-off is the user's responsibility to implement software encryption. This is a manageable task.

The Build Quality and Longevity Factor


The physical construction of the WALRAM M.2 NGFF SATA3 SSD, visible as a bare PCB with mounted components, emphasizes its functional design. The 2280 designation refers to its dimensions: 22mm wide and 80mm long, a standard size for M.2 drives. The components are surface-mounted.

This compact design allows for easy integration into slim laptops and small form factor desktops where space is at a premium. The absence of a bulky enclosure, typical of 2.5-inch SATA SSDs, further contributes to its versatility. Its small footprint is a major advantage.

Unlike larger, encased drives, the M.2 form factor requires careful handling during installation to avoid damaging the exposed circuitry. However, once installed and secured, its solid-state nature ensures long-term reliability without the wear and tear associated with mechanical parts. This drive is built to last.

Thermal Management and Operational Quietness


SSDs inherently generate less heat and operate silently compared to traditional hard drives. The WALRAM M.2 NGFF SATA3 SSD benefits from this fundamental characteristic. Its low power consumption directly translates to reduced heat output, which is particularly beneficial in confined spaces like laptops or compact desktop builds. Cooler components last longer.

The absence of any moving parts means the drive produces absolutely no operational noise. This contributes to a quieter overall system, enhancing the user experience, especially in environments where silence is valued, such as home offices or media centers. No whirring, no clicking.

This contrasts sharply with the audible hum and occasional clicks of a spinning hard drive, which can be a constant distraction. The silent operation of an SSD is a quality-of-life improvement often underestimated until experienced. It is a welcome change.
